  FLSA: Non-Exempt   Temporary/Continuing:  Continuing   Part-Time/Full-Time: Full-Time   Union Group: N/A   Term of Position: 12 Month   At Will/Just Cause: Just Cause   Summary of Position: Coordinate video and multimedia content for website and social media, assist in managing social media outlets, assist in coordination and production of broadcasts and press conferences, assist in media coverage and publicity for 17 varsity programs, assist in department marketing efforts, serve in various announcing and interviewing roles.
The selected candidate for this position must be authorized to work in the United States at the time of hire without employer assistance or sponsorship now or in the future. The university will not assist with any F1 EAD's, OPT, H1B, etc.   Position Type: Staff   Required Education: Two years of completed college coursework.
Required Work Experience: Previous experience in multimedia and creative content, social media, communications and video operations.

  Additional Education/Experiences to be Considered: Past experience in broadcasting, hosting and managing press conferences, and developing social media outreach. Previous experience in broadcasting NCAA Division I Hockey or other sports as a play -by-play or color commentator will also be considered.
Essential Duties/Responsibilities: Primary duties & responsibilities for various sports coverage
Video & multimedia content for website and social media
Serve in announcing and interviewing roles
Coordination of in-game broadcast and video operations
Website maintenance, design and updates
Manage Social media - Facebook, Twitter, YouTube, etc.
Production of releases and game notes for assigned sports
Carries out responsibilities in accordance with university policies and applicable laws.
Cultivates an environment of belonging that values, respects, supports, and celebrates individual similarities and differences, allowing students, faculty, and staff to thrive authentically.
Support, promote, and develop university student enrollment and retention initiatives.
Any other duties assigned within the position classification area.
Marginal Duties/Responsibilities: Nominations of student-athletes for awards, etc.
Weekly reporting to conference and national offices (GLIAC, CCHA, NCAA)
Maintain historical and archived files of releases, statistics, etc.
Design work for website, flyers, posters, schedule cards, etc.
Email and text messaging service coordination
Produce advertising radio/tv spots, Bulldog Sports Update, Coaches Corner, etc.
Production of game flipcards/programs for assigned sports
Help direct and coordinate student employees/interns
Coordination of video board and marquee signage
